OD Hunte is a London based record producer, songwriter, rapper and singer. Primarily known for his work in hip hop, OD Hunte has produced albums and singles for a number of artists from the late 1990s to the present day.
Trinidadian born producer / writer OD Hunte owes his start in music production in part to the famed producer Teddy Riley. Although he had already been writing songs for several years when he moved to the UK it wasn’t until a friend handed him a DAT of out-takes of the Bobby Brown “Two Can Play That Game” master that he began to really become interested in the art of production.
After graduating with a Physics and Modern Acoustics Degree OD became one of the first UK producers to start selling sample CDs internationally and the resulting Freekee Jack Swing and 96th Street were calling cards for his introduction to Extreme Music, one of the largest publishers in TV, film and commercials. OD went on to produce an album and several tracks for the LA based music company.
Missy Elliott also personally called OD to request some backing tracks for her artists after hearing his work with singer Chantal Brown (Do Me Bad Things/ Atlantic).
In 2007 Hunte became a platinum songwriter thanks to his co-written track ‘I Was Born’ on Natalia Druyts’ SonyBMG release ‘Everything and More” which stayed at number 1 in the Belgian national charts for five weeks. His tracks have also featured in American Pie 6 Beta House and Paula Abdul’s Hey Paula (Get Them Hands Hi track by his group Ten Days Till).
Many of the artists that OD has produced, written for, remixed or mixed have also seen great success. Leona Lewis became a global star after spectacularly winning The X Factor 2006 competition, Leon Jean-Marie signed to Island Records, and Tendai Tyson found his creative and commercial home in the group Unkle Jam (Virgin).
Hunte has also placed two tracks in major international games alongside platinum artists Akon, Gnarls Barkley, Black Eyed Peas, Lupe Fiasco and Dipset. The placement of Crook Dancin’ by Slic One in EA Sports Fight Night Round 3 and then Get Them Hands Hi in EA Sports NBA Live.
Get Them Hands Hi featured vocals by international star Lifford who found fame through the Artful Dodger’s Please Don’t Turn Me On. Other shows to feature Hunte's tracks include MTV's Pimp My Ride, Next, Makin’ The Band, Yo Momma and Run's House, Date My Mom, Punk’d and literally hundreds of other shows. Films have included American Pie 6, Dirty Pretty Things (Makin of A Million), Farce of the Penguins (Slic One - From The Start) with Samuel L Jackson and in 2007 Ping Pong Playa (Slic One - Wake Up Call). OD has also recently entered into the world of music video direction, with his debut featuring Slic One's new track Straight Knockin’.
